A typical household distribution box includes a main switch, separate circuits for lighting, room sockets, and high-power appliances, with breakers rated according to load and safety standards.
By following this configuration, a household distribution box can safely manage electricity, isolate faults, and accommodate future upgrades while protecting both people and appliances.
